In chiles as well as tomatoes there are 2 diseases; V wilt verticillium
and F wilt Fusarium AKA the Chile wilt..

Near the end of the thread you will note that the V wilt likes a soil pH of
6.5 and lower, The F wilt likes a soil pH of 7.5 and higher.
So a very simple Duh, To avoid these wilts keep the soil pH between 6.5 and
7.5
